Eau Cerise presents a mix of floral and woody elements anchored by patchouli and oakmoss. The scent carries Bulgarian and Egyptian rose alongside violet and champaca, giving the blend a layered floral character. Sea buckthorn and galbanum add a bright, slightly green edge, while ambrette contributes a musky softness. Licorice weaves through the composition with a dark, slightly bitter thread that keeps the sweeter notes from dominating. Atlas and Virginia cedar provide a dry, woody backdrop that feels steady rather than sharp. The overall impression is powdery and earthy, with warm spicy accents that sit close to the skin.
